Silversand Road, off Casuarina Rd, Malindi
Q48G+M79, Casuarina Rd, Malindi
PW47+R68, Corniche Path, Shela
C112 Hindi, Lamu, Kenya
MWWF+8P2, Manda Island, Shela
Vision Towers, 4th floor, Muthithi Road, Parklands, Nairobi, KENYA
Casuarina Rd, Malindi
Casuarina Road, Malindi
Malindi Town, Casuarina Rd, Kilifi
Q459+PC8, Ebony Road, Malindi
Mahogany Rd, Malindi
Maring Park Rd, Malindi